Job Title:
Project Coordinator Company Overview At The Intersect Group, we are partnering with a well established infrastructure services organization that supports critical power delivery and utility operations across large scale distribution and transmission networks. The company has decades of experience delivering engineering, construction, and maintenance solutions and operates in a fast paced, high volume environment where accuracy, efficiency, and teamwork are essential to success. Role Summary We are seeking a Project Coordinator I to support a high volume utility distribution program by managing documentation, billing processes, and coordination across project teams. This role is essential to maintaining operational efficiency, financial accuracy, and compliance across multiple active projects. You will work closely with Project Managers, field teams, and client stakeholders to ensure invoices are processed accurately, documentation is complete, and communication flows smoothly across all parties. The ideal candidate thrives in fast paced environments, is highly detail oriented, and brings strong organizational and interpersonal skills. Key Responsibilities
  • Prepare, review, and maintain project documentation including work orders permits and compliance forms
  • Ensure all documentation meets contractual requirements and regulatory standards
  • Verify billing accuracy against approved work orders and project budgets
  • Investigate and resolve invoicing discrepancies in coordination with internal teams
  • Serve as a liaison between project managers field teams and client representatives
  • Maintain consistent communication regarding project status billing cycles and documentation needs
  • Update project trackers databases and reporting tools for distribution projects
  • Generate reports on invoicing status outstanding items and compliance metrics
  • Support audits and internal reviews with accurate and organized documentation
  • Assist project managers and team members with administrative and operational tasks as needed Key Requirements
  • 2 plus years of experience in project coordination administrative support or billing and invoicing roles
  • Experience supporting construction utilities electrical or distribution projects preferred
  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el and the broader Microsoft Office suite
  • Demonstrated ability to manage high volume workloads with accuracy and attention to detail
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with customer facing experience
  • Ability to work effectively in fast paced environments with quick turnaround timelines
  • Self starter mindset with the ability to prioritize and adapt
  • Associate degree or equivalent experience in business administration project management or related field Success Profile
  • Reliable and accountable professional who takes ownership of work
  • Team oriented with a collaborative and approachable working style
  • Detail driven with the ability to quickly identify and resolve discrepancies
  • Comfortable supporting multiple project managers across a dynamic workload Interview Process
  • Initial phone screening with recruiter
  • One onsite panel interview with leadership and project management team Contract Details
  • Estimated 6 month contract
  • Full time 40 hours per week with potential for 5 to 10 hours overtime after ramp up
